Spring Live Auction - Session 1

You are viewing artwork included in Session 1 of the Cowley Abbott Spring Live Auction of Important Canadian Art, taking place on Thursday, May 30th at Toronto's Globe & Mail Centre. In-Person, Absentee, Telephone and Real-Time Online Bidding is available to collectors for participation in this auction. Purchased artwork is subject to the 20% Buyer's Premium (21% if purchased via Auction Mobility's interface) and applicable taxes. Further details regarding buying with Cowley Abbott can be found by referring to our Conditions of Sale and the "How to Purchase" page.

The first session of the Spring Live Auction presents an exciting selection of work by Canadian and international artists, with many making their auction debut with Cowley Abbott this season. Entrusted to our team by national and international private collectors, estates, corporations and trade clients, these artworks were acquired through private channels, at auction, from commercial galleries or from the artists directly.
